138777765025 has 12 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 172183324924. Its totient is φ = 110958408000.
The previous prime is 138777765023. The next prime is 138777765053. The reversal of 138777765025 is 520567777831.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 6 ways, for example, as 45333223056 + 93444541969 = 212916^2 + 305687^2 .
It is not a de Polignac number, because 138777765025 - 21 = 138777765023 is a prime.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×1387777650252 (a number of 23 digits) contains 22 as substring.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(138777765023)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 11 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1550706 + ... + 1637755.
Almost surely, 2138777765025 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
138777765025 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(33405559899).
138777765025 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
138777765025 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 3190212 (or 3190207 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 17287200, while the sum is 58.
